Our grid's balancing act would make a circus performer sweat. With 33% renewable targets by 2030 and monsoon-dependent hydropower, the need for energy storage solutions becomes glaring. Remember last December's grid instability in Penang? That wasn't just a technical glitch - it was a preview of our fossil-fuel-free future's growing pains.

Western solutions often flop here. Our 35°C average temps degrade batteries 30% faster than in temperate climates. Pro Tec's secret sauce? A cooling system inspired by traditional Malay rumah ventilation - passive, low-cost, and brutally effective.
